|
@@ -54,7 +54,7 @@
|
|
|
</template>
|
|
|
|
|
|
<script>
|
|
|
-import { username, password } from "@/plugins/formRules";
|
|
|
+import { password } from "@/plugins/formRules";
|
|
|
import { login, subjectDetail } from "@/api";
|
|
|
import ResetPwd from "./ResetPwd";
|
|
|
|
|
@@ -68,7 +68,14 @@ export default {
|
|
|
password: ""
|
|
|
},
|
|
|
loginRules: {
|
|
|
- loginName: username,
|
|
|
+ loginName: [
|
|
|
+ {
|
|
|
+ required: true,
|
|
|
+ pattern: /^[a-zA-Z0-9_-]{2,40}$/,
|
|
|
+ message: "用户名只能包含字母、数字、下划线以及短横线",
|
|
|
+ trigger: "change"
|
|
|
+ }
|
|
|
+ ],
|
|
|
password
|
|
|
},
|
|
|
rightRoutes: {
|